I love H&M homeware, nothing is over priced and is of comparable quality to items sold elsewhere for sometimes a fair bit more. The only think I don't like is waiting, if an item is in stock it arrives quickly but if it is on back order be prepared to wait and for the dates to continually change. I would personally prefer if the item was unavailable to buy until it is ready to ship but ho hum, worth it when it does arrive.

H&M is awesome for cushions. I especially love their velvet cushions as they are really hardworking and come in the most amazing colours. The other two cushions are a kind of canvas and are a great way of adding colour for a tiny price tag.
